White-tipped Quetzal Pharomachrus fulgidus

Described by: Gould (1838)
Alternate common name(s): White-tipped Trogon
Old scientific name(s): None known by website authors

Range

Ex. n. South America;
Two populations;
Restricted range;
(1) Ne. Colombia (Santa Marta Mountains).
(2) Ne. and nc. Venezuela.
